Milan Kravárik

Milan holds a Master’s degree in Economics from the Slovak University of Agriculture in Nitra and has pursued professional certifications, including ACCA studies and the Certified Accountant qualification.

He is a finance professional with more than 15 years of experience in financial management, audit, and corporate finance and currently serves as Group Chief Financial Officer, where he oversees financial management across multiple entities, including Cambridge International School, Funiversity Cambridge Kindergartens, and the Patronka Campus Project.

Before joining Cambridge, Milan held several senior finance roles, including Group CFO at Heneken Group, where he contributed to the development of the group’s financial management and reporting framework across multiple international entities. Earlier in his career, Milan worked for Big Four firms Deloitte and KPMG, where he led audit engagements for major companies across industries including retail, FMCG, construction, and automotive. His work focused on financial statement audits under IFRS, US GAAP, German GAAP, and Slovak accounting standards, as well as advisory projects and group IFRS consolidations.

Outside of his professional career, Milan is passionate about martial arts and sports and holds a black belt in karate.
